ENVIRONMENT AND SOCIETY


Environment Brafer’s environmental awareness starts with its main raw material: steel. Besides being durable, it is also recyclable, replacing the use of wood in civil construction.

Brafer seeks to contribute to the conservation of the environment through processes that further increase the durability of steel, reduce scrap and follow waste management programs, along with monitoring the emission of greenhouse gases and effluent treatments.

Attesting our commitment to reduce the impact of our activities, the company is certified by the ISO 14001 Standard. The standard guarantees the effective management of environmental issues in a system that prioritises the management of environmental impacts, satisfies the given the legal requirements and increases the awareness of all the company’s employees.

In addition to all the daily actions taken, in 2009, an area of environmental protection, which covers 20 hectares of native forest, was included in the company’s assets. Registered with the Environmental Institute of Paraná (IAP), the forest is located on the outskirts of the metropolitan region of Curitiba. A wealth of flora and fauna was identified in its grounds. Among the list of species of trees, there are specimens of Imbuia, Cinnamon, Sassafras, Rosewood, Caviúna and Monjoleiro, and over seven hundred Araucaria pines.

SOCIETY

Brafer has a tradition of supporting social projects. Over nearly 40 years of the company’s history there have been various institutions that have relied on our support for the maintenance or improvement of their activities.

Institutions like APAE Araucaria, the Pequeno Principe Hospital, the Erasto Gaertner Hospital, the Pro-Renal Institute, the Pequeno Cotolengo Institution and the Junior Achievement Association are some that have relied on the cooperation of the company over the years - for both resources and the dedication of the company’s employees who are involved in volunteering activities.
